Blender 2.81 CUDA vs. OptiX Performance

Blender 2.81 NVIDIA CUDA and OptiX benchmarks by Michael Larabel for a future article.

HTML result view exported from: https://openbenchmarking.org/result/1911258-HU-BLENDER2807.

Blender 2.81 CUDA vs. OptiX PerformanceProcessorMotherboardChipsetMemoryDiskGraphicsAudioMonitorNetworkOSKernelDesktopDisplay ServerDisplay DriverOpenGLVulkanCompilerFile-SystemScreen ResolutionGTX 970GTX 980GTX TITAN XGTX 1060GTX 1070GTX 1080GTX 1080 TiGTX 1650GTX 1660GTX 1660 SUPERGTX 1660 TiRTX 2060RTX 2060 SUPERRTX 2070RTX 2070 SUPERRTX 2080RTX 2080 SUPERRTX 2080 TiTITAN RTXIntel Core i9-9900KS @ 5.00GHz (8 Cores / 16 Threads)ASUS PRIME Z390-A (1302 BIOS)Intel Cannon Lake PCH16384MBSamsung SSD 970 EVO 250GB + 2000GB SABRENTeVGA NVIDIA GeForce GTX 970 4GB (1163/3505MHz)Realtek ALC1220Acer B286HKIntel I219-VUbuntu 19.105.3.0-23-generic (x86_64)GNOME Shell 3.34.1X Server 1.20.5NVIDIA 440.314.6.01.1.119GCC 9.2.1 20191008ext43840x2160NVIDIA GeForce GTX 980 4GB (1126/3505MHz)NVIDIA GeForce GTX TITAN X 12GB (1001/3505MHz)NVIDIA GeForce GTX 1060 6GB (1506/4006MHz)NVIDIA GeForce GTX 1070 8GB (1506/4006MHz)NVIDIA GeForce GTX 1080 8GB (1607/5005MHz)NVIDIA GeForce GTX 1080 Ti 11GB (1480/5508MHz)ASUS NVIDIA GeForce GTX 1650 4GB (1485/4001MHz)ASUS NVIDIA GeForce GTX 1660 6GB (435/405MHz)eVGA NVIDIA GeForce GTX 1660 SUPER 6GB (480/405MHz)eVGA NVIDIA GeForce GTX 1660 Ti 6GB (1500/6000MHz)NVIDIA GeForce RTX 2060 6GB (1365/7000MHz)NVIDIA GeForce RTX 2060 SUPER 8GB (1470/7000MHz)ASUS NVIDIA GeForce RTX 2070 8GB (420/405MHz)NVIDIA GeForce RTX 2070 SUPER 8GB (1605/7000MHz)Zotac NVIDIA GeForce RTX 2080 8GB (1515/7000MHz)NVIDIA GeForce RTX 2080 SUPER 8GB (375/405MHz)NVIDIA GeForce RTX 2080 Ti 11GB (450/810MHz)NVIDIA TITAN RTX 24GB (1350/7000MHz)OpenBenchmarking.orgProcessor Details- Scaling Governor: intel_pstate powersave - CPU Microcode: 0xc6OpenCL Details- GTX 970: GPU Compute Cores: 1664- GTX 980: GPU Compute Cores: 2048- GTX TITAN X: GPU Compute Cores: 3072- GTX 1060: GPU Compute Cores: 1280- GTX 1070: GPU Compute Cores: 1920- GTX 1080: GPU Compute Cores: 2560- GTX 1080 Ti: GPU Compute Cores: 3584- GTX 1650: GPU Compute Cores: 896- GTX 1660: GPU Compute Cores: 1408- GTX 1660 SUPER: GPU Compute Cores: 1408- GTX 1660 Ti: GPU Compute Cores: 1536- RTX 2060: GPU Compute Cores: 1920- RTX 2060 SUPER: GPU Compute Cores: 2176- RTX 2070: GPU Compute Cores: 2304- RTX 2070 SUPER: GPU Compute Cores: 2560- RTX 2080: GPU Compute Cores: 2944- RTX 2080 SUPER: GPU Compute Cores: 3072- RTX 2080 Ti: GPU Compute Cores: 4352- TITAN RTX: GPU Compute Cores: 4608Security Details- itlb_multihit: KVM: Vulnerable + l1tf: Not affected + mds: Not affected + meltdown: Not affected + spec_store_bypass: Mitigation of SSB disabled via prctl and seccomp + spectre_v1: Mitigation of usercopy/swapgs barriers and __user pointer sanitization + spectre_v2: Mitigation of Enhanced IBRS IBPB: conditional RSB filling + tsx_async_abort: Mitigation of TSX disabled

Blender 2.81 CUDA vs. OptiX Performanceblender: BMW27blender: Classroomblender: Fishy Catblender: Barbershopblender: Pabellon BarcelonaGTX 970GTX 980GTX TITAN XGTX 1060GTX 1070GTX 1080GTX 1080 TiGTX 1650GTX 1660GTX 1660 SUPERGTX 1660 TiRTX 2060RTX 2060 SUPERRTX 2070RTX 2070 SUPERRTX 2080RTX 2080 SUPERRTX 2080 TiTITAN RTXCUDA: GTX 970CUDA: GTX 980CUDA: GTX TITAN XCUDA: GTX 1060CUDA: GTX 1070CUDA: GTX 1080CUDA: GTX 1080 TiCUDA: GTX 1650CUDA: GTX 1660CUDA: GTX 1660 SUPERCUDA: GTX 1660 TiCUDA: RTX 2060CUDA: RTX 2060 SUPERCUDA: RTX 2070CUDA: RTX 2070 SUPERCUDA: RTX 2080CUDA: RTX 2080 SUPERCUDA: RTX 2080 TiCUDA: TITAN RTXOptiX: RTX 2060OptiX: RTX 2060 SUPEROptiX: RTX 2070OptiX: RTX 2070 SUPEROptiX: RTX 2080OptiX: RTX 2080 SUPEROptiX: RTX 2080 TiOptiX: TITAN RTX172.00436.99373.651530.06996.81160.79410.39334.211313.78901.47136.33320.55279.54993.53713.03147.66475.47296.301415.25995.05103.88322.54202.90975.33680.4285.89253.31169.21754.03565.1759.74173.23118.25514.30383.26144.29499.89270.731626.361062.5791.07326.92170.111071.61673.4184.43309.88156.211026.10628.2087.64311.78159.851039.12639.4271.92294.27128.711019.05565.1060.79290.95113.22998.37527.4061.82298.02114.581020.18538.6949.48165.6687.37543.35344.6550.68164.8987.38541.88345.3649.63157.2986.27514.81335.7439.42151.8869.32526.00284.2635.55146.9463.92512.15272.3738.73149.1765.901743.02214.0231.55145.0258.911736.52197.3831.71148.1258.841770.36201.6827.3191.3445.64986.55139.0328.1989.0243.74960.66140.0027.6584.4641.21899.71134.2321.4375.9134.50908.56110.3219.9373.1931.98886.52105.18OpenBenchmarking.org

Blender

Blend File: BMW27

CUDAOptiXOpenBenchmarking.orgSeconds, Fewer Is BetterBlender 2.81Blend File: BMW27GTX 970GTX 980GTX TITAN XGTX 1060GTX 1070GTX 1080GTX 1080 TiGTX 1650GTX 1660GTX 1660 SUPERGTX 1660 TiRTX 2060RTX 2060 SUPERRTX 2070RTX 2070 SUPERRTX 2080RTX 2080 SUPERRTX 2080 TiTITAN RTX4080120160200SE +/- 0.03, N = 3SE +/- 0.30, N = 3SE +/- 0.34, N = 3SE +/- 0.21, N = 3SE +/- 0.31, N = 3SE +/- 0.27, N = 3SE +/- 0.18, N = 3SE +/- 0.13, N = 3SE +/- 0.01, N = 3SE +/- 0.01, N = 3SE +/- 0.03, N = 3SE +/- 0.15, N = 3SE +/- 0.23, N = 3SE +/- 0.27, N = 3SE +/- 0.02, N = 3SE +/- 0.02, N = 3SE +/- 0.02, N = 3SE +/- 0.15, N = 3SE +/- 0.04, N = 3SE +/- 0.01, N = 3SE +/- 0.01, N = 3SE +/- 0.02, N = 3SE +/- 0.02, N = 3SE +/- 0.01, N = 3SE +/- 0.03, N = 3SE +/- 0.03, N = 3SE +/- 0.01, N = 3172.00160.79136.33147.66103.8885.8959.74144.2991.0784.4387.6471.9260.7961.8249.4850.6849.6339.4235.5538.7331.5531.7127.3128.1927.6521.4319.93

Blender

Blend File: Classroom

CUDAOptiXOpenBenchmarking.orgSeconds, Fewer Is BetterBlender 2.81Blend File: ClassroomGTX 970GTX 980GTX TITAN XGTX 1060GTX 1070GTX 1080GTX 1080 TiGTX 1650GTX 1660GTX 1660 SUPERGTX 1660 TiRTX 2060RTX 2060 SUPERRTX 2070RTX 2070 SUPERRTX 2080RTX 2080 SUPERRTX 2080 TiTITAN RTX110220330440550SE +/- 0.09, N = 3SE +/- 0.34, N = 3SE +/- 0.44, N = 3SE +/- 0.59, N = 3SE +/- 0.15, N = 3SE +/- 0.28, N = 3SE +/- 0.34, N = 3SE +/- 0.06, N = 3SE +/- 0.16, N = 3SE +/- 0.02, N = 3SE +/- 0.02, N = 3SE +/- 0.04, N = 3SE +/- 0.29, N = 3SE +/- 0.17, N = 3SE +/- 0.35, N = 3SE +/- 0.05, N = 3SE +/- 0.26, N = 3SE +/- 0.82, N = 3SE +/- 0.60, N = 3SE +/- 0.16, N = 3SE +/- 0.35, N = 3SE +/- 0.22, N = 3SE +/- 0.11, N = 3SE +/- 0.05, N = 3SE +/- 0.08, N = 3SE +/- 0.56, N = 3SE +/- 0.55, N = 3436.99410.39320.55475.47322.54253.31173.23499.89326.92309.88311.78294.27290.95298.02165.66164.89157.29151.88146.94149.17145.02148.1291.3489.0284.4675.9173.19

Blender

Blend File: Fishy Cat

CUDAOptiXOpenBenchmarking.orgSeconds, Fewer Is BetterBlender 2.81Blend File: Fishy CatGTX 970GTX 980GTX TITAN XGTX 1060GTX 1070GTX 1080GTX 1080 TiGTX 1650GTX 1660GTX 1660 SUPERGTX 1660 TiRTX 2060RTX 2060 SUPERRTX 2070RTX 2070 SUPERRTX 2080RTX 2080 SUPERRTX 2080 TiTITAN RTX80160240320400SE +/- 0.15, N = 3SE +/- 0.06, N = 3SE +/- 0.08, N = 3SE +/- 0.11, N = 3SE +/- 0.04, N = 3SE +/- 0.12, N = 3SE +/- 0.08, N = 3SE +/- 0.02, N = 3SE +/- 0.05, N = 3SE +/- 0.05, N = 3SE +/- 0.03, N = 3SE +/- 0.05, N = 3SE +/- 0.14, N = 3SE +/- 0.16, N = 3SE +/- 0.03, N = 3SE +/- 0.03, N = 3SE +/- 0.03, N = 3SE +/- 0.04, N = 3SE +/- 0.05, N = 3SE +/- 0.05, N = 3SE +/- 0.08, N = 3SE +/- 0.02, N = 3SE +/- 0.04, N = 3SE +/- 0.01, N = 3SE +/- 0.02, N = 3SE +/- 0.07, N = 3SE +/- 0.19, N = 3373.65334.21279.54296.30202.90169.21118.25270.73170.11156.21159.85128.71113.22114.5887.3787.3886.2769.3263.9265.9058.9158.8445.6443.7441.2134.5031.98

Blender

Blend File: Barbershop

CUDAOptiXOpenBenchmarking.orgSeconds, Fewer Is BetterBlender 2.81Blend File: BarbershopGTX 970GTX 980GTX TITAN XGTX 1060GTX 1070GTX 1080GTX 1080 TiGTX 1650GTX 1660GTX 1660 SUPERGTX 1660 TiRTX 2060RTX 2060 SUPERRTX 2070RTX 2070 SUPERRTX 2080RTX 2080 SUPERRTX 2080 TiTITAN RTX400800120016002000SE +/- 0.10, N = 3SE +/- 0.76, N = 3SE +/- 0.99, N = 3SE +/- 0.04, N = 3SE +/- 0.16, N = 3SE +/- 0.10, N = 3SE +/- 0.12, N = 3SE +/- 0.17, N = 3SE +/- 0.15, N = 3SE +/- 0.19, N = 3SE +/- 0.11, N = 3SE +/- 0.08, N = 3SE +/- 0.64, N = 3SE +/- 0.07, N = 3SE +/- 0.06, N = 3SE +/- 0.23, N = 3SE +/- 0.08, N = 3SE +/- 0.26, N = 3SE +/- 0.59, N = 3SE +/- 1.05, N = 3SE +/- 1.16, N = 3SE +/- 1.09, N = 3SE +/- 0.91, N = 3SE +/- 0.36, N = 3SE +/- 0.81, N = 3SE +/- 0.08, N = 3SE +/- 1.59, N = 31530.061313.78993.531415.25975.33754.03514.301626.361071.611026.101039.121019.05998.371020.18543.35541.88514.81526.00512.151743.021736.521770.36986.55960.66899.71908.56886.52

Blender

Blend File: Pabellon Barcelona

CUDAOptiXOpenBenchmarking.orgSeconds, Fewer Is BetterBlender 2.81Blend File: Pabellon BarcelonaGTX 970GTX 980GTX TITAN XGTX 1060GTX 1070GTX 1080GTX 1080 TiGTX 1650GTX 1660GTX 1660 SUPERGTX 1660 TiRTX 2060RTX 2060 SUPERRTX 2070RTX 2070 SUPERRTX 2080RTX 2080 SUPERRTX 2080 TiTITAN RTX2004006008001000SE +/- 0.34, N = 3SE +/- 0.13, N = 3SE +/- 0.27, N = 3SE +/- 0.17, N = 3SE +/- 0.13, N = 3SE +/- 0.15, N = 3SE +/- 0.08, N = 3SE +/- 0.08, N = 3SE +/- 0.06, N = 3SE +/- 0.03, N = 3SE +/- 0.59, N = 3SE +/- 0.21, N = 3SE +/- 0.01, N = 3SE +/- 0.13, N = 3SE +/- 0.10, N = 3SE +/- 0.06, N = 3SE +/- 0.07, N = 3SE +/- 0.07, N = 3SE +/- 0.04, N = 3SE +/- 0.17, N = 3SE +/- 0.20, N = 3SE +/- 0.27, N = 3SE +/- 0.03, N = 3SE +/- 0.03, N = 3SE +/- 0.03, N = 3SE +/- 0.46, N = 3SE +/- 0.39, N = 3996.81901.47713.03995.05680.42565.17383.261062.57673.41628.20639.42565.10527.40538.69344.65345.36335.74284.26272.37214.02197.38201.68139.03140.00134.23110.32105.18


Phoronix Test Suite v10.8.4